Welcome aboard. Furrowlink ingests tractor and combine telemetry from the Dresselvale test farms and forwards it to the fleet dashboard. Contractors get read access on day one; write access after the security briefing. Clone the gateway repo, run the simulator, and confirm packets appear in the staging dashboard before touching production configs. Keep the edge nodes on the pinned firmware version. Your encrypted dev environment is pre-provisioned; to decrypt it on first boot, you will need the recovery passphrase, which is provided below.

unlock words, hahip-yagef: zorok-novmir-zorix-silax

Q3 Planning Note — Board of Varnholt Industries

Effective immediately, all hiring in the Coastal Systems division is frozen through year-end. Open requisitions are cancelled; backfills require CEO sign-off. Driver: margin compression in the Tellmark contract and slower bookings in the Arden region. Payroll savings estimated at 4% of divisional opex. Other divisions unaffected. Review at the January board session. Maren Odquist will circulate the adjusted staffing model. Full rationale follows below.

management briefing: The renewal with Zoraelax Group closes at $10 million a year, 15 percent below the last contract. Project Ralael slips by six weeks because of the audit delay.

# Encoding detection fixture for the Textweave upload pipeline.
# These sample files exercise the charset sniffer: UTF-8 with and
# without BOM, Latin-1, and a deliberately malformed Shift-JIS blob.
# Support folks: if a customer reports garbled uploads, reproduce by
# running this fixture against the staging detector before escalating
# to the Marleth platform team. The detector falls back to UTF-8 when
# confidence drops below 0.6. Staging calls require the token below.

session JWT of yawep-yawep = eyJhbGciOiJIUzI1NiIsInR5cCI6IkpXVCJ9.eyJzdWIiOiI3pWF3_In0.aXYsHiog

- [ ] Step 7: Archive cold storage buckets (Glacierline tier). Confirm both ceremony witnesses are present, verify bucket manifests match the Oxbow ledger, then seal the archive key shares. Plugin authors may observe but not handle shares. Once sealed, the archive index itself is encrypted and can only be reopened with the passphrase below.

vault phrase of badup-hahig = tamael-aldael-kelmir-istael-fenok-istwyn-tamius-jorath-oliion